Introduction to Swansea’s Culinary Scene
Swansea, a vibrant coastal city in Wales, offers a culinary scene that beautifully reflects its rich cultural heritage and natural bounty. The local cuisine styles are diverse, influenced by both traditional Welsh dishes and contemporary gastronomic trends. From rustic pubs to upscale restaurants, the dining landscape is a feast for the senses, showcasing authentic flavors and innovative uses of local ingredients.
One cannot mention Swansea’s culinary delights without highlighting the fresh seafood, perfectly complemented by the picturesque setting of the waterfront. Local specialties like cockles and laverbread are must-tries, often featured in culinary tours that explore the city’s gastronomic gems. Food festivals throughout the year further celebrate these regional specialties, attracting food enthusiasts eager to sample gourmet experiences and discover hidden gems.
Dining reviews of Swansea’s eateries often highlight the unique fusion of flavors that chefs bring to their menus. Meal suggestions range from classic Welsh lamb dishes to contemporary interpretations that embrace international influences, ensuring there’s something for everyone.
